Alternative Ingredient Suggestions

If you want to customize your Teriyaki Ground Turkey Broccoli and Peas, there are plenty of easy swaps. Ground chicken or lean beef can replace turkey if preferred. For a vegetarian version, try tofu or plant-based crumbles.

You can also switch broccoli with green beans, bell peppers, or snap peas for a different texture. If you prefer a homemade touch, make your own teriyaki sauce using soy sauce, ginger, garlic, and a sweetener like honey or brown sugar.

For a low-carb variation of Teriyaki Ground Turkey Broccoli and Peas, serve it over cauliflower rice instead of traditional white rice.

Step-by-Step Instructions for Teriyaki Ground Turkey Broccoli and Peas

  1. Start by cooking your rice according to package instructions if you plan to serve Teriyaki Ground Turkey Broccoli and Peas over rice. Set aside once done.
  2. Prepare all vegetables by chopping the broccoli into bite-sized pieces, shredding the carrots, dicing the onion, and mincing the garlic. Having everything ready will make cooking faster and smoother.
  3.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and minced garlic, cooking until the onion becomes soft and translucent. This step builds the flavor base for your Teriyaki Ground Turkey Broccoli and Peas.
  4. Add the ground turkey to the skillet. Break it apart using a spatula and cook until it is no longer pink. Stir occasionally to ensure even cooking.
  5. Mix in the broccoli, shredded carrots, and peas. Stir well to combine all ingredients. Cover the pan and let the vegetables cook until slightly tender, about 3 to 4 minutes. The broccoli should still have a slight crunch.
  6. Pour the teriyaki sauce over the mixture. Stir everything together so the sauce evenly coats the turkey and vegetables. Let it simmer for another 1 to 2 minutes until the sauce is heated through and slightly thickened.
  7. Serve the Teriyaki Ground Turkey Broccoli and Peas over cooked rice or your preferred base. Enjoy while warm for the best flavor and texture.

Tips and Tricks for the Best Teriyaki Ground Turkey Broccoli and Peas

To get the most out of your Teriyaki Ground Turkey Broccoli and Peas, avoid overcooking the vegetables. Keeping broccoli slightly crisp preserves both texture and nutrients.

Use a large skillet or wok to ensure even cooking and prevent overcrowding. This helps the ingredients cook properly instead of steaming.

If your sauce feels too thick, add a splash of water to loosen it. On the other hand, if you prefer a thicker glaze, let it simmer a bit longer.

Taste before serving and adjust seasoning if needed. Some teriyaki sauces are saltier than others, so balance accordingly.

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to four days. Teriyaki Ground Turkey Broccoli and Peas also reheats well, making it perfect for meal prep.

Teriyaki Ground Turkey Broccoli and Peas

  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ings
  • Diet: Low Fat

Ingredients

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 3 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 1/2 cups white onion, chopped
  • 1 lb (450 g) lean ground turkey
  • 1 cup shredded carrots
  • 2 cups broccoli florets, chopped
  • 1 cup frozen peas
  • 1 1/2 cups teriyaki sauce
  • 4 cups cooked rice (optional, for serving)


Instructions

  1. Cook 1 1/2 cups of rice according to package instructions and set aside.
  2. Prepare the vegetables by chopping broccoli, shredding carrots, dicing onion, and mincing garlic.
  3. Heat 1 tablespoon ol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add garlic and onion, cooking for 1-2 minutes until fragrant and translucent.
  4. Add 1 lb ground turkey and cook, breaking it apart, until no longer pink.
  5. Stir in broccoli, carrots, and peas. Cover and cook for 3-4 minutes until vegetables are slightly tender.
  6. Pour in 1 1/2 cups teriyaki sauce and stir well to coat all ingredients evenly.
  7. Simmer for 1-2 minutes until the sauce is heated through and slightly thickened.
  8. Serve hot over cooked rice or your preferred base.

Notes

  • Do not overcook broccoli to keep it crisp and vibrant.
  • Use low-sodium teriyaki sauce for a healthier option.
  • You can substitute ground turkey with ground chicken, beef, or tofu.
  • Store leftovers in the refrigerator for up to 4 days in an airtight container.
  • This recipe freezes well for up to 3 months.
